Arlo William Dyk, 73, Strasburg, ND, died Sunday, April 22, 2012 in the Linton Hospital. A memorial service will be held at 3:00 p.m. Wednesday, April 25, 2012 at the Myers Funeral Home Chapel, Linton, ND. Burial will be held at a later date at Westfield Cemetery, Westfield, ND. Arlo was born April 29, 1938 on a farm near Strasburg, ND, the son of William and Freda (Droog) Dyk. He was raised and educated in the Bakker School District. Arlo married Delma Grace Millenaar on July 19, 1955. They lived in several places in North Dakota and South Dakota before settling back in Strasburg. Arlo was a carpenter, but always had a love for farming. Arlo retired in 2011 and returned to his family farm. He was a member of the Harley Davidson Owners Group and the Hope Reformed Church in Westfield. Arlo enjoyed riding his "Harley", spending time with his family and friends and working with his hands. He is survived by two sons and daughter in-law: Delmer and Diane Dyk, Bismarck, ND and Dennis Dyk (Marian Hapip), Mandan, ND; two daughters and sons-in-law: Darlene and Clinton Kost, Herreid, SD and Arvetta and Felix Krumm, Oakes, ND; nine grandchildren; three great-grandchildren; three step grandchildren; three step great-grandchildren; two sisters and brother-in-law: Beverly Wittenberg, Bismarck, ND and Karen and James McCulloch, Almont, ND; and a special friend, Julie Job, Fargo, ND. He was preceded in death by his parents, and one brother-in-law: Fred Wittenberg.
